HB 2431 Texas House · 89th Legislature (2025)

Relating to a permit authorizing the movement of certain vehicles transporting an intermodal shipping container.

HB 2431 restricts permits for vehicles transporting intermodal shipping containers to specific routes within Texas. It requires these permits to be limited to highways in the state highway system located in counties with over 90,000 residents and within 30 miles of the Texas-Arkansas border. The bill directly affects commercial trucking companies moving shipping containers across these designated routes. The amendment to the Transportation Code takes effect September 1, 2025.
